KARACHI: Meher Ali Baloch’s second-half goal saw Bulle Ji Baloch Football Club record a 1-0 victory against Shafi Mohammadan Football Club to win the All Karachi Shaheed Shoaib Hingora Memorial Football Tournament here at Kalri Football Ground in Lyari.

Young Hingora Football Club organised the tournament in collaboration with DMC South.

During the closing ceremony, DMC South Chairman Malik Mohammad Fayyaz Awan distributed prizes among the winners and runners-up team. The winning side cashed Rs30,000 while the runners-up pocketed Rs20,000. The scorer of the final, Meher, received Rs3,000.

Moreover, track suits, kits and other prizes were also distributed among the players.

Addressing the participants during the ceremony, Fayyaz praised the people of Lyari for being sports- and peace-loving.

“If better infrastructure and resources are made available for these players better results could be expected from them,” he said.
